curl -sSL http://git.io/git-extras-setup | sudo bash /dev/stdinFirst, please install Git for Windows 2.x from 'https://github.com/git-for-windows/git/releases'
and the basic msys2.
Second, clone the git-extras repo into any folder you like.
git clone https://github.com/tj/git-extras.gitAfter that, open the script install.cmd in the folder with any text editor you like.
Modify the PREFIX variable to where your Git for Windows 2.x is installed.
For example, I install it in the folder called C:\SCM\PortableGit and
the PREFIX should be C:\SCM\PortableGit\mingw64 (for 64-bit release)
or C:\SCM\PortableGit\mingw32 (for 32-bit release).
Third, execute the install.cmd directly or in the command prompt.
Last, please copy colrm.exe and column.exe from folder-your-msys2-installed/usr/bin to
folder-your-git-installed/usr/bin.
